Proprietary Knowledge Objects

• Defined in a vendor-specific syntax

• Controlled by a closed, proprietary model

• Dependent on that vendor for all processing

• Integration is application-based with increasing marginal costs of exchange

• Real-time dependence on specific commercial platforms

Page 10: From Objects to Assets: The Fungibility of Knowledge Christopher W. Higgins, Esq

Generic Knowledge Objects

• Defined in a public meta-syntax

• Controlled by an open, dynamic model

• Independent of any vendor for processing

• Integration is information-based with diminishing marginal costs of exchange

• Real-time interoperability among commercial trading platforms
